MILWAUKEE STEW

Category: Stews
    Prep Time:       Cook Time:       Total Time:  

1/4 cup flour
Salt and pepper, to taste
1 lb pork, cut into medium cubes
1 tbsp oil
2 medium onions, diced
1/2 tsp minced garlic and caraway seed
1 cup chicken broth and beer
1 tbsp red wine vinegar and packed brown sugar

Heat oil in a soup pot. Blend together flour, salt and pepper. Toss the pork in the flour and brown in the hot oil. Add the onions and cook 4 minutes. Add the garlic and cook 1 minute longer. Stir in the remaining ingredients. Bring to a boil, reduce the heat and simmer for 1 1/2 hours or until the pork is tender. Serve warm. Serves 4
